WebThe salutation is the opening line of your email where you address the recipient directly, usually by name. In business letters, your choices for salutations are limited to phrases such as: Dear Ms. Smith: Dear Max: To Whom It May Concern: In the world of email, however, a number of salutation styles are acceptable. WebMar 10, 2024 · Make sure to also include their name in this salutation, as it’s a sign of respect and business appropriate. Examples would include “ Hi Don ” or “ Hello Susan. ”. WebJul 21, 2024 · “Good morning,” “Good afternoon,” and “Good evening,” are good to use when you are addressing multiple recipients with your email. You can also use them for semi-formal and impersonal emails. Such greetings are a good fit for routine emails.
